Discussions
Join the NetSuite community to innovate, connect, and discover what’s next.
SuiteWorld brings thousands of innovators, builders, and leaders together to learn, connect, and shape what’s next. This October, explore how to build a stronger foundation for growth through inspiring keynotes, major product reveals, hands-on sessions, and unforgettable moments—all in one place for our biggest event of the year. Register now
NSC | Resolve: INSUFFICIENT_PERMISSION Error
SuiteScript's flexibility empowers users to efficiently manage records by loading and modifying them while creating or editing other records. For instance, during the process of saving a new sales order, developers can utilize the record.load() function to access the current user's employee record, ensuring their authorization. Alternatively, they might employ the record.create() function to generate a new record within the afterSubmit function of a User Event Script.
In scenarios where the "Execute as Administrator" checkbox is unchecked in the Script Deployment record, and the user's role lacks permission to access the specific record type being loaded or created in the background, SuiteScript will issue an "INSUFFICIENT_PERMISSION" error.
Expand your NetSuite knowledge by joining this month's Ask A Guru Live: PROCURE TO PAY. RSVP on this event now!
Refer a Member to the Community | Earn the Answer Accepter Badge | Vote for the contents you'd like to see
